Before you go any further, the next step is finding out simply who your market is. There are 2 basic markets you can offer to: consumer and company. These divisions are relatively obvious. For instance, if you're selling women's clothing from a retailer, your target market is consumers; if you're selling office supplies, your target market is organizations (this is referred to as "B2B" sales).

Walmart and Tiffany are both retailers, however they have very various specific niches: Walmart caters to bargain-minded shoppers, while Tiffany appeals to upscale jewelry consumers."Many individuals talk about "finding' a specific niche as if it were something under a rock or at the end of the rainbow, ready-made.

These individuals quickly discover a hard lesson, Falkenstein alerts: "Smaller sized is larger in business, and smaller is not all over the map; it's highly focused."Developing an excellent niche, Falkenstein advises, involves following a seven-step process: With whom do you want to do service?

Clarify what you want to offer, keeping in mind that a) you can't be all things to all individuals and b) smaller is bigger. Your specific niche isn't the exact same as the field in which you work. A retail clothing company is not a specific niche but a field. A more specific niche might be "maternity clothes for executive ladies."To begin this focusing procedure, Falkenstein suggests utilizing these methods to help you: Make a list of things you do best and the abilities implicit in each of them.

Identify the most crucial lessons you've learned in life. Search for patterns that reveal your design or method to dealing with problems. Your specific niche needs to occur naturally from your interests and experience. For instance, if you spent ten years working in a consulting company but likewise spent 10 years working for a small, family-owned business, you may choose to begin a consulting organization that specializes in small, family-owned companies.

The very best method to do this is to talk with potential customers and recognize their main issues. At this phase, your specific niche must start to take shape as your ideas and the client's needs and desires coalesce to develop something brand-new. A good niche has five qualities: It takes you where you want to goin other words, it complies with your long-lasting vision.

"It progresses, enabling you to establish different profit centers and still keep the core organization, therefore ensuring long-term success. Possibly you'll discover that the specific niche you had in mind requires more organization travel than you're prepared for.

Scrap it, and move on to the next concept. When you have a match in between specific niche and product, test-market it. "Provide individuals a chance to buy your product or servicenot just theoretically but really putting it out there," Falkenstein suggests. This can be done by offering samples, such as a totally free mini-seminar or a sample copy of your newsletter.
